Cookies and Tracking Technologies: When you visit or otherwise interact with our Services, we may automatically collect information about you using cookies, device identifiers, web beacons, SDKs, pixels and similar technologies. We use this information for various purposes, including to make the Services function properly, understand how you use the Services, personalize your experience, gather usage data on our Services, measure, manage, display and customize the advertisements you see within the Services or elsewhere and improve your overall experience while using the Services. A “cookie” is a piece of information sent to your browser by a website you visit. Cookies can be stored on your computer for different periods of time. Some cookies expire after a certain amount of time, or upon logging out (session cookies), others survive after your browser is closed until a defined expiration date set in the cookie (as determined by the third party placing it), and help recognize your computer when you open your browser and browse the Internet again (persistent cookies). Online Tracking and Do Not Track Signals: We and our third-party service providers may use cookies, pixels, or other tracking technologies to collect information about your browsing activities over time and across different websites following your use of the Site and use that information to send targeted advertisements. Because there currently isn’t an industry or legal standard for recognizing or honoring “Do Not Track” (“DNT”) signals, we do not currently respond to them at this time, and we instead operate as described in this Privacy Notice whether or not a DNT signal is received. If we do respond to DNT signals in the future, we will update this Privacy Notice to describe how we do so. For details, including how to turn on Do Not Track, visit www.donottrack.us.
